使用CSS样式表的好处主要体现在以下几个方面:
代码分离与维护
- 内容与样式分离:CSS允许开发者将HTML文档的内容与样式分离,使得代码更加清晰,易于维护。例如,可以通过外部CSS文件管理样式,减少HTML文件中的代码量。
- 提高开发效率:修改CSS文件即可全局更新页面样式,极大提高了开发效率。
页面性能优化
- 减少页面加载时间:通过外部链接CSS文件,可以减少重复代码,提高页面加载速度。浏览器可以缓存外部样式文件,进一步加快加载速度。
浏览器兼容性
- 支持多种浏览器:CSS支持多种浏览器,确保网页在不同浏览器中的一致性。
样式效果丰富
- 多样化的样式属性:CSS提供了丰富的样式属性,如颜色、字体、布局等,使得网页设计更加多样化。
结构与内容分离
- 结构清晰,易于搜索引擎优化:CSS使得结构与内容分离,不仅提高了页面的视觉效果,还有助于搜索引擎优化,使内容更容易被搜索引擎索引。
灵活性与可重用性
- 样式可重用:可以在外部样式表中定义一次样式并将其应用于多个网页,确保整个网站的一致性。
- 响应式设计:通过媒体查询和灵活的布局模型(如flexbox和grid),CSS可实现响应式设计,确保网页无缝适应不同的屏幕尺寸和设备。
通过使用CSS,开发者可以创建更加美观、功能丰富且用户友好的网页。